Dava Newman: Director of the MIT Media Lab, the Mecca of Global Innovation

 

Dava Newman is the Director of the MIT Media Lab. She holds the title of Apollo Program Professor of Astronautics at the Massachusetts Institute of Technology (MIT) and is a faculty member of the Harvard-MIT Program in Health Sciences and Technology in Cambridge, Massachusetts.


She was appointed as a MacVicar Faculty Fellow—an honor recognizing her significant contributions to undergraduate education—and served as the Director of the Technology and Policy Program (TPP) at MIT from 2003 to 2015. From 2011 to 2015 and 2017 to 2021, she served as the Director of the MIT-Portugal Program. As the head of TPP, she led this unique, multidisciplinary graduate program alongside more than 1,300 alumni and faculty members across all five schools within the Institute. She has been a member of the faculty at the MIT School of Engineering and the Department of Aeronautics and Astronautics for 28 years and holds a Top Secret security clearance. 

 

Dr. Dava Newman also served as the Deputy Administrator of NASA (2015–2017). Nominated by President Barack Obama and unanimously confirmed by the U.S. Senate in April 2015, she worked alongside the NASA Administrator to articulate the agency's vision, provide overall leadership and policy direction, and represent NASA to the Executive Office of the President and Congress.
